By default, both paired and unpaired positions display, by underlying securities.
To group positions, from Group By, select:
Expiration
Positions are grouped from the closest to the furthest expiration date. Strategies involving more than one expiration date are grouped according to the closest expiration date. Unpaired positions or strategies with no expiration dates are shown below the furthest expiration.
Strategy
Positions are grouped in alphabetical order according to strategy.
Underlying
Positions are grouped in alphabetical order according to the underlying security.
